Sha256: 531d40e440bbb9f496f7a294d2dbaac722aac90795c7dff61c3736432f7f926b

Contents?: true

Size: 358 Bytes

Versions: 4

Compression:

Stored size: 358 Bytes

Contents

# frozen_string_literal: true

require_relative 'comment'

module Codeowners
  class Checker
    class Group
      # Define line type GroupEndComment which is used for defining the end
      # of a group.
      class GroupEndComment < Comment
        def self.match?(line)
          line.lstrip.start_with?(/^#+ END/)
        end
      end
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
codeowners-checker-1.0.3 lib/codeowners/checker/group/group_end_comment.rb
codeowners-checker-1.0.2 lib/codeowners/checker/group/group_end_comment.rb
codeowners-checker-1.0.1 lib/codeowners/checker/group/group_end_comment.rb
codeowners-checker-1.0.0 lib/codeowners/checker/group/group_end_comment.rb